一种支持人工智能教学实验的可编程小车制造技术

技术编号:25089054 阅读:23 留言:0更新日期:2020-07-31 23:33
本发明专利技术涉及教育设备技术领域,且公开了一种支持人工智能教学实验的可编程小车,包括车体,所述车体的顶部设置有PLC控制器,所述PLC控制器侧面的底端安装有固定块,所述固定块的表面皆开设有限位孔,所述车体的顶部开设有凹槽,所述凹槽的内部设置有固定杆。该一种支持人工智能教学实验的可编程小车,通过设置限位孔、限位插销和PLC控制器,使得本发明专利技术具有便捷组装功能和提高学生自主创意功能的优点,有效提高安装速率,且可以从主机或平板通过HTTP/SSH/VNC访问,通过Scratch、Python或Jupyter编写程序,适合语音、图像、无人驾驶等课程,支持学生自主创意的人工智能应用实现,该可编程小车主要供学生学习人工智能方面的应用为主,里面内置教学实验环境,便于学习。

【技术实现步骤摘要】
一种支持人工智能教学实验的可编程小车
本专利技术涉及教育设备
,具体为一种支持人工智能教学实验的可编程小车。
技术介绍
机器人是自动执行工作的机器装置。它既可以接受人类指挥,又可以运行预先编排的程序,也可以根据以人工智能技术制定的原则纲领行动。它的任务是协助或取代人类工作的工作,例如生产业、建筑业,或是危险的工作,现在市场上有很多应用于教育领域的机器人产品,其中智能车是较为常见的一种形式,以轮式机器人底盘为基础,可扩展各类传感器和执行器,智能车是电子计算机等最新科技成果与现代汽车工业相结合的产物,其中两轮智能车,由单片机控制小车前进,左转,右转。目前,智能车在使用前需要用户自行固定组装,且连接方式主要以螺丝加螺母为主,致使使用者在固定连接时,需要花费大量的时间和精力去连接组装,组装速率低,严重降低工作效率,实用性低,同时,现有的智能车无法使学生的自主创意力得到显著的体现,影响自主学习的效率,在功能性上还有待提高,因此需要对其进行改进。
技术实现思路
针对现有技术的不足,本专利技术提供了一种支持人工智能教学实验的可编程小车,具备便捷组装功能和提高学生自主创意功能的优点,解决了现有的智能车在使用前需要用户通过外部螺丝和螺母进行自行组装,在安装的过程中需要耗费大量的时间和精力,费时费力,不但安装速率低,而且影响工作效率,同时,现有的智能车无法使学生的自主创意力得到显著体现,影响自主学习的效率,在功能性上还有待提高。本专利技术提供如下技术方案:一种支持人工智能教学实验的可编程小车,包括车体,所述车体的顶部设置有PLC控制器,所述PLC控制器侧面的底端安装有固定块,所述固定块的表面皆开设有限位孔,所述车体的顶部开设有凹槽,所述凹槽的内部设置有固定杆,所述固定杆的尾端通过复位弹簧与凹槽内部的底端连接,所述固定杆的一侧安装有限位插销,所述限位插销设置在限位孔的内部。优选的,所述限位插销设置为L型状,所述车体的内部安装有马达模块,所述车体底部的四角皆安装有驱动轮,所述PLC控制器的内部安装有无线模块和语音输出模块,所述车体底部的中间位置处开设有安装槽,所述安装槽的内部安装有蓄电池,所述安装槽处的车体底部设置有安装盖。该可编程小车的使用方法包括以下步骤:步骤一、在可编程小车播报或显示IP地址后,在平板或电脑上通过浏览器或客户端软件访问可编程小车的IP地址,访问可编程小车上的系统或人工智能教学实验环境,具体为:在平板或电脑上通过SSH客户端,以文本模式访问可编程小车上的系统,在平板或电脑上通过VNC客户端,以图形模式访问可编程小车上的系统,在平板或电脑上通过浏览器,访问可编程小车上的人工智能教学实验环境;步骤二、以文本模式或图形模式连接可编程小车上的系统时,修改可编程小车上的人工智能教学实验环境中的数据或配置;步骤三、以浏览器方式连接可编程小车时,访问可编程小车上的人工智能教学实验环境,包括Scratch学习环境、Python学习环境或其他学习环境。优选的,可编程小车包含无线模块、马达模块、语音输入模块、语音输出模块、摄像头模块和显示模块。优选的,可编程小车包含Linux操作系统、Scratch在线环境/Jupyter在线环境、人工智能模块和插件、基于Scratch和Python的课程。优选的,可编程小车通过手机热点或无线路由器连接到一个无线网络。优选的,可编程小车接通电源后,系统启动,通过无线模块获取到IP地址。优选的,可编程小车获取的IP地址后,通过语音输出模块播报IP地址,或者通过显示模块显示IP地址。优选的,平板或电脑连接到可编程小车所在的相同无线网络。与现有技术对比,本专利技术具备以下有益效果:1、该一种支持人工智能教学实验的可编程小车,通过设置限位插销和限位孔,使得本专利技术具有便捷组装功能,有效提高组装速率,从而提高工作效率,具有较高的实用性,在使用时,使用者将PLC控制器放在车体的顶部,并通过提拉固定杆,使固定杆的尾端拉动复位弹簧的顶端,进而将限位插销的底部正对限位孔,使复位弹簧在自身特性为恢复形变产生收缩的作用力,进而使固定杆受到向下的拉力,从而导致限位插销插入限位孔的内部,实现快速卡接组装,方便快捷,有效提高工作效率。2、该一种支持人工智能教学实验的可编程小车,通过设置PLC控制器,使得本专利技术可以从主机或平板通过HTTP/SSH/VNC访问,通过Scratch、Python或Jupyter编写程序,适合语音、图像、无人驾驶等课程,支持学生自主创意的人工智能应用实现,在使用时,因PLC控制器内部包含语音输出模块和无线模块,进而当车体在通电的情况下,使得系统在启动下通过无线模块获取到IP地址,而后通过语音输出模块进行播报IP地址,进而使用者可通过平板或电脑连接到本专利技术所在的相同无线网络,并通过浏览器或客户端软件访问本专利技术的IP地址,访问本专利技术的人工智能教学实验环境,该可编程小车主要供学生学习人工智能方面的应用为主,里面内置教学实验环境,便于学习。附图说明图1为本专利技术结构示意图;图2为本专利技术主视图;图3为本专利技术小车硬件组成图;图4为本专利技术小车软件组成图;图5为本专利技术小车使用连接图;图6为本专利技术小车使用步骤图;图中:1、车体;2、驱动轮;3、安装槽;4、蓄电池;5、安装盖;6、PLC控制器;7、固定块;8、限位插销;9、限位孔;10、复位弹簧;11、凹槽;12、固定杆。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。请参阅图1-6,一种支持人工智能教学实验的可编程小车,包括车体1,车体1的内部安装有马达模块,车体1底部的四角皆安装有驱动轮2,马达模块的输出端与驱动轮2连接,方便马达模块在运行时提供动力带动驱动轮2进行转动,使得车体具有移动性,方便实现移动,车体1底部的中间位置处开设有安装槽3,安装槽3的内部安装有蓄电池4,可便于蓄电池4为本专利技术提供电力支持,安装槽3处的车体1底部设置有安装盖5,车体1的顶部设置有PLC控制器6,本专利技术PLC控制器6设置为树莓派,PLC控制器6的内部安装有无线模块和语音输出模块,可便于使用者通过手机热点或无线路由器连接到一个网络,并在蓄电池4通电的情况下,使本专利技术实现正常运行,进而可通过无线模块获取到IP地址,当获取IP地址后,可通过语音模块播报IP地址,而后,使用者可通过SSH客户端,以文本模式访问车体1上的系统,通过VNC客户端,以图形模式访问车体1上的系统,并通过浏览器,访问车体1上的人工智能教学实验环境,在以文本模式或图形模式访问车体1上的系统时,可修改车体1上的人工智能教学实验环境中的数据或配置,而车体1上的人工智能教学实验环境包括Scratch学习环境,Pyt本文档来自技高网...

【技术保护点】
1.一种支持人工智能教学实验的可编程小车,包括车体(1),其特征在于:所述车体(1)的顶部设置有PLC控制器(6),所述PLC控制器(6)侧面的底端安装有固定块(7),所述固定块(7)的表面皆开设有限位孔(9),所述车体(1)的顶部开设有凹槽(11),所述凹槽(11)的内部设置有固定杆(12),所述固定杆(12)的尾端通过复位弹簧(10)与凹槽(11)内部的底端连接,所述固定杆(12)的一侧安装有限位插销(8),所述限位插销(8)设置在限位孔(9)的内部。/n

【技术特征摘要】
1.一种支持人工智能教学实验的可编程小车,包括车体(1),其特征在于:所述车体(1)的顶部设置有PLC控制器(6),所述PLC控制器(6)侧面的底端安装有固定块(7),所述固定块(7)的表面皆开设有限位孔(9),所述车体(1)的顶部开设有凹槽(11),所述凹槽(11)的内部设置有固定杆(12),所述固定杆(12)的尾端通过复位弹簧(10)与凹槽(11)内部的底端连接,所述固定杆(12)的一侧安装有限位插销(8),所述限位插销(8)设置在限位孔(9)的内部。


2.根据权利要求1所述的一种支持人工智能教学实验的可编程小车,其特征在于:所述限位插销(8)设置为L型状,所述车体(1)的内部安装有马达模块,所述车体(1)底部的四角皆安装有驱动轮(2),所述PLC控制器(6)的内部安装有无线模块和语音输出模块,所述车体(1)底部的中间位置处开设有安装槽(3),所述安装槽(3)的内部安装有蓄电池(4),所述安装槽(3)处的车体(1)底部设置有安装盖(5)。


3.根据权利要求1-2中任一项所述的可编程小车,其特征在于:该可编程小车的使用方法包括以下步骤:
步骤一、在可编程小车播报或显示IP地址后,在平板或电脑上通过浏览器或客户端软件访问可编程小车的IP地址,访问可编程小车上的系统或人工智能教学实验环境,具体为:在平板或电脑上通过SSH客户端,以文本模式访问可编程小车上的系统,在平板或电脑上通过VNC客户端,以图形模式访问可编程小车上的系统,在平板或电脑上通过浏览器,访问可编程小车上的人工智...

【专利技术属性】
技术研发人员:敖青云
申请(专利权)人:无锡深帆信息科技有限公司
类型:发明
国别省市:江苏;32

相关技术
    暂无相关专利
网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1